nervous
/ˈnɜrvəs/
adjective
- Easily agitated or alarmed; tending to be anxious or worried.
- She is a nervous person who gets scared by loud noises.
- The nervous cat hid under the bed during the storm.
- He felt nervous before his first day at the new school.
- Feeling worried or uneasy about something that is going to happen.
- I'm nervous about my driving test tomorrow.
- She gave a nervous laugh when the teacher called on her.
- The students were nervous as they waited for their exam results.
- Relating to the nerves or the nervous system.
- Doctors studied the nervous pathways in the brain.
- The nervous system controls all the body's functions.
- Damage to nervous tissue can cause loss of feeling.
